Using AWS Step Functions with a Choice state, how can one check if a value in the input is equal to an empty string?
IsPresentmay be used to check if a particular key exists in the input, but it will return true for an empty string.StringEqualsmay be used to compare a string key against a non-empty valueStringMatchesmay be used to compare a string key against a non-empty wildcard (*) pattern
Setting StringEmpty's or StringMatches's comparison value to empty is invalid in the Workflow Studio UI.

This is a bug/issue in the current version of the AWS Console Workflow Studio. Comparing to empty is valid, but the UI disallows this configuration via client-side validation.

The StringEquals condition matches an empty string as you would expect.
"EmptyString?": {
"Type": "Choice",
"Choices": [
{
"Variable": "$.TestField",
"StringEquals": "",
"Next": "EmptyString"
}
],
"Default": "NotEmptyString"
},
An empty string in the input matches the StringEquals "" choice:
{
"TestField": ""
}
